Bishop met Domingo Chavez in Venezuela. They both belonged to separate Ranger companies, but were left stranded after an ambush that left most of Bishop's companions dead. Over the following week, they both made their way through the jungle, encountering and exterminating several ragtag bands of militia. By the time they make it back to base, they were solid friends.
Several years later, Bishop was brought into Rainbow by Domingo. Bishop has had a lot of battlefield experience, but is relatively inexperienced as a commander. Bishop has tried to compensate for this by studying military tactics extensively. Combined with his/her strong charisma and courage under fire, his/her deep knowledge of tactics led Six (Domingo) to appoint him/her head of Bravo team in 2005.
More experienced than Logan -- Bishop trained him when Logan first joined – they both know every textbook tactical maneuver code. Bishop rose through the ranks rapidly, quickly becoming a team leader. During his/her few years at the top, he has never failed a mission.
Bishop's look and gender may vary, because the players can use the PEC to modify Bishop's looks. A wide variety of clothes, hats/helmets, bulletproof vests and camouflages/pattern are available ; for example, US Army's ACU, Canadian Forces CADPAT and UK's Desert DPM camos are available, as is Rainbow's traditionnal light blue and black uniforms.
In game, the team's camouflage is the same as the one selected by the player for Bishop : it means that if the player selected the Olive Green Camouflage, Jung Park, Michael Walters, Sharon Judd and Gary Kenyon will be seen wearing it too. This works only with camos, however ; the aforementionned NPCs won't sport other helmets, vests and clothes than the Rainbow signature ones.
